Welcome back to an all-new episode of the Grand Valley State Sports Report on WGVU!
GVSU continues their search for a national championship with a gritty win in the playoffs. GVSU Cross Country heads to the DII National Championships this week. Laker Women’s Basketball moves to 5-0 with another win. And our feature this week highlights some key players on the Laker Football D-Line.
